[Webkit-unassigned] [Bug 105389] New: Web Inspector: AuditLauncherView UI components should be disabled until ongoing audit finishes

bugzilla-daemon at webkit.org bugzilla-daemon at webkit.org
Tue Dec 18 22:38:15 PST 2012


https://bugs.webkit.org/show_bug.cgi?id=105389

           Summary: Web Inspector: AuditLauncherView UI components should
                    be disabled until ongoing audit finishes
           Product: WebKit
           Version: 528+ (Nightly build)
          Platform: All
        OS/Version: All
            Status: NEW
          Severity: Normal
          Priority: P2
         Component: Web Inspector
        AssignedTo: webkit-unassigned at lists.webkit.org
        ReportedBy: vivekg at webkit.org
                CC: keishi at webkit.org, pmuellr at yahoo.com,
                    pfeldman at chromium.org, yurys at chromium.org,
                    apavlov at chromium.org, loislo at chromium.org,
                    vsevik at chromium.org,
                    web-inspector-bugs at googlegroups.com


Currently when we are running audits, the button changes its label to "Stop". So we can trigger cancelling of the ongoing audit request.

At the same time, the check-boxes for the category are enabled. So if the user de-selects every category while the request is still on going, the "Stop" button becomes disabled. Hence the audit request cannot be cancelled. This can be avoided if AuditLauncherView UI components are disabled until ongoing audit finishes.

Patch follows.

-- 
Configure bugmail: https://bugs.webkit.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.



More information about the webkit-unassigned mailing list